Output 58fbf56e3c926b95f422b5d8a765d14dec57c036e4e227bbd2b0327519028d1c:6

value
222300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ae342ffaf9a63d0a363f642cffcde8c57557ef61 OP_EQUAL
address
3Ha81y6Zpo5AVHHDGn9RSrfjmuPt4qwNnL
transaction
58fbf56e3c926b95f422b5d8a765d14dec57c036e4e227bbd2b0327519028d1c
spent
true